Lehrmann v Network Ten Pty Limited (Livestream) [2023] FCA 1452 File number: NSD 103 of 2023
Judgment of: LEE J
Date of judgment: 22 November 2023
Catchwords: PRACTICE AND PROCEDURE – open justice – whether defamation trial should be livestreamed – where objection to livestream raised by media company – reality that it is not merely of some importance but is of fundamental importance that justice should not only be done, but should manifestly and undoubtedly be seen to be done – hearing to continue to be livestreamed to facilitate the public interest in open justice subject to any further application establishing it is necessary to take a contrary course in relation to particular evidence – alternative course as reflected in proposed orders refused
